Named in memory of Kaoru Akiyama (1901–1970), professor at Hosei University, Tokyo, during 1930–1940 and 1949–1970, well known for his work on minor planets. Initially in collaboration with K. Hirayama {see minor planet (1999)}, he made the first detailed study of the orbit of the 3/2 commensurability object (153) Hilda. (M 5014) _ _.
Discovered on 1-12-1978 in Harvard by Harvard Observatory
